Training of Ukrainian pilots on F-16 fighters may begin in the coming weeks.

This was stated by the head of the Pentagon Lloyd Austin at a meeting of "Ramstein" may 25.

"Last week, President Biden announced that the United States will support joint efforts with our allies and partners to train Ukrainian pilots on fourth-generation aircraft, including the F-16. We hope that these exercises will begin in the coming weeks," he said.

According to the head of the Pentagon, the exercises will help strengthen and improve the capabilities of the Ukrainian Air Force in the long term. It will also complement short- and medium-term security agreements.

Austin added that the joint efforts of allies are intended to demonstrate the unity of partners and long-term commitment to Ukraine's self-defense.

We will remind, the UK will be one of the first countries to begin training the Ukrainian military on Western F-16 fighters.

The Air Force says that Ukrainian pilots have extensive experience and hours of flying, including combat ones. Therefore, everyone will be trained abroad individually.
